We are seeking a highly skilled Full Stack Developer with a passion for building responsive and user-friendly websites. The ideal candidate will have extensive experience in both frontend and backend development, with a strong understanding of UI/UX principles and website optimization. You will be responsible for designing, developing, and maintaining web applications that enhance user experience and meet business goals.
Qualifications:
Education: Bachelors degree in Computer Science, Information Technology, or a related field.
Experience:
3 years of experience in full stack web development.
Proven experience in both frontend and backend development projects.
Technical Skills:
Proficiency in frontend technologies: HTML5, CSS3, JavaScript, and frameworks like React, Angular, or Vue.
Strong knowledge of backend technologies: Node.js, Express, PHP, or Python.
Experience with databases: MySQL, MongoDB, PostgreSQL, etc.
Understanding of RESTful APIs and web services.
UI/UX Skills:
Familiarity with design tools (e.g., Adobe XD, Figma, Sketch).
Knowledge of responsive design principles and accessibility standards.
Soft Skills:
Strong problem-solving skills and attention to detail.
Excellent communication and teamwork abilities.
Ability to work independently and manage multiple tasks effectively.
Preferred Qualifications:
Experience with cloud platforms (e.g., AWS, Azure) is a plus.
Familiarity with version control systems (e.g., Git).
Knowledge of Agile methodologies.
Role and Description:
Website Development Maintenance:
o Design, develop, and maintain responsive and dynamic websites.
o Ensure website functionality, performance, and security through regular maintenance and updates.
Frontend Development:
o Build engaging user interfaces using HTML, CSS, JavaScript, and relevant frameworks (e.g., React, Angular, Vue).
o Collaborate with designers to implement UI/UX best practices for optimal user experience.
Backend Development:
o Develop server-side logic using languages such as Node.js, PHP, Python, or Ruby.
o Manage database integration and optimization (e.g., MySQL, MongoDB, PostgreSQL).
UI/UX Design:
o Understand user requirements and translate them into functional design specifications.
o Conduct usability testing and gather feedback to continuously improve website design.
Website Optimization:
o Implement SEO best practices to enhance visibility and traffic.
o Optimize web applications for maximum speed and scalability.
Collaboration:
o Work closely with cross-functional teams, including designers, product managers, and other developers.
o Participate in code reviews, design discussions, and team meetings to foster collaboration and knowledge sharing.
What We Offer:
Competitive salary and benefits package.
Opportunities for professional growth and development.